Armstrong World Industries (AWI) is anAmericas leader in the design and manufacture of innovative interior and exterior architectural applications including ceilings, specialty walls and exterior metal solutions. With approximately $1.4 billion in revenue, AWI has about 3,700 employees and a manufacturing network of 21 facilities in North America.
